Ban Blanket No Pet Clauses in Tenancy Agreements & Leases.

Closed 7,662 signatures

What the petition asks

We call on the government to introduce legalisation that bans no pet clauses in tenancy agreements, protecting existing human companion animal relationships, as is common in many countries. Every pet has the right to a loving home.
In proposing a review of the model tenancy agreement the government recognises the importance of pets to people, & how traumatic it is to have to give up a pet when moving into rental housing. This however is not enough, we call on our government to go further. Without legislation like that proposed in 'Jasmine's Law' landlords can still include blanket bans on pets.

Changes in legalisation would open doors for love and companionship for many humans and animals.
